The Journey of a Single Mother: Navigating Through Challenges and Embracing New Opportunities

Introduction

Life as a single mother can be incredibly challenging, especially when faced with financial struggles, the absence of skills, and a lack of employment opportunities. However, with perseverance, faith, and a willingness to learn and grow, every obstacle presents an opportunity for change. This article provides guidance and practical advice for single mothers like yourself to overcome these challenges and move towards a more stable and fulfilling life.

Embracing Hope and Gratitude

It’s important to hold onto hope, believing that every door that closes will be replaced by many more opened by divine grace. Belief in a higher power and maintaining hope can provide a ray of light in often dark situations.

Assessing Your Situation and Setting Priorities

After acknowledging the reality of your situation, the next step is to stop what you've been doing and evaluate your current path. Getting out of a negative mindset and redefining your priorities is crucial. Make a list of what you can control and what steps you can take to improve your life. Take a moment to ask yourself:
Are you willing to start small and do what needs to be done? Are you prepared to learn new skills and work on your communication and interpersonal abilities? Are you ready to seek help from your local welfare office, churches, or other community resources? Is it time to embrace a situation where a job, even a low-paying one, is better than staying in a position of inaction and despair?

Exploring Employment Opportunities

One of the most compelling steps is to seek job opportunities, starting with the smallest tasks. Embracing any job, no matter how humble, is a step towards self-improvement and financial stability. Focus on developing your social skills, learning how to collaborate, and understanding professional ethics. These are valuable skills that can be applied in various roles and industries.

Seeking Support and Guidance

Connecting with community resources such as local welfare offices can provide the necessary support and guidance. Visiting a local welfare office and requesting assistance can provide you with the tools and resources to start anew.

Religious support can also be invaluable. Visiting churches and seeking prayer and counseling from a pastor, especially Baptist churches, can offer comfort and guidance. Remember, asking for help is a sign of strength, not weakness.
